The continuous process of bone remodeling

Bone is a dynamic tissue that is constantly being broken down and rebuilt through a process called remodeling. This occurs throughout the entire skeleton, including the bones of the face. While the net increase in size seen during adolescence ceases, the subtle reshaping of facial bones continues [1]. This remodeling can lead to gradual alterations in the contours and proportions of the face over time.

Specific areas of the adult face are more susceptible to these changes:

  • Midface and Orbital Area: Studies indicate that the bones surrounding the eyes (orbits) tend to enlarge with age due to bone resorption. The midface, including the maxilla (upper jaw), can also experience a degree of bone loss, which can affect its projection and contribute to changes in facial shape [1].
  • Mandible and Jawline: Although the size of the mandible (lower jaw) generally stabilizes, remodeling continues. The angle of the jaw may become wider, and bone density can be affected by factors like tooth loss [2]. Some research suggests minimal ongoing growth in certain facial areas like the jaw, nose, and ears throughout life [3].
  • Nasal Bones: The bony structure supporting the nose also undergoes changes, including enlargement of the piriform aperture (the nasal opening in the skull), which can subtly alter the appearance of the nose over time [1].

Soft tissue's significant role in adult facial aesthetics

The overall appearance of your face is not solely determined by bone structure. The overlying soft tissues – skin, fat, muscle, and ligaments – also play a crucial role and undergo significant changes in adulthood. These soft tissue changes often become more noticeable than the subtle shifts in the underlying bone.

  • Fat Redistribution and Loss: The subcutaneous fat pads that give the face a youthful fullness change with age. They can lose volume and descend due to gravity and the natural aging process. This shift contributes to the formation of jowls, deepening of nasolabial folds (lines from the nose to the mouth), and hollowing under the eyes [4].
  • Collagen and Elastin Degradation: The skin's structural integrity relies heavily on collagen and elastin fibers. As individuals age, the production of these proteins decreases, and existing fibers degrade. This leads to reduced skin elasticity, increased laxity, and the formation of wrinkles and sagging [5].
  • Muscle and Ligament Changes: Over time, repetitive facial muscle movements contribute to expression lines. Changes in facial ligaments, which help support the facial tissues, can also reduce their ability to counteract gravity, further contributing to sagging [6].

Environmental and lifestyle factors influencing adult facial aging

While genetics provide a blueprint, a variety of external factors significantly impact how your facial structure and appearance evolve after age 17. These influences can accelerate or mitigate the visible signs of aging.

  • Oral Health and Dental Care: The presence and health of your teeth are intrinsically linked to jawbone structure. Tooth loss can lead to bone resorption in the jaw, altering the shape of the lower face and chin. Regular dental checkups and addressing issues like tooth loss or malocclusion (improper bite) are vital for maintaining facial structure [2]. Orthodontic treatments in adulthood can also impact jaw alignment and facial symmetry [7].
  • Diet and Nutrition: A balanced diet rich in calcium, vitamin D, and other essential nutrients is crucial for maintaining bone density and overall health, which in turn supports facial structure. Adequate hydration also contributes to skin health and elasticity [8].
  • Sun Exposure: Chronic exposure to ultraviolet (UV) radiation from the sun is a primary cause of premature skin aging, known as photoaging. UV rays break down collagen and elastin, accelerating wrinkle formation and sagging [5]. Protecting your skin with sunscreen is essential for preserving its structure and appearance.
  • Smoking: Smoking is highly detrimental to skin health. It reduces blood flow, impairs collagen production, and accelerates the breakdown of elastic fibers, leading to increased wrinkles, sallowness, and a generally aged appearance [5].
  • Posture: Poor posture, particularly forward head posture often associated with using electronic devices, can affect the alignment of the jaw and neck, potentially influencing the contours of the lower face over time.

Promoting healthy facial aging

While the natural progression of aging is inevitable, several strategies can help support healthy facial structure and appearance after 17. Focusing on overall health and protecting the skin are key components.

  1. Prioritize Oral Health: Maintain excellent dental hygiene, attend regular checkups, and address any tooth loss promptly to preserve jawbone structure [2]. Consider orthodontic consultations if needed [7].
  2. Protect Your Skin from the Sun: Consistent use of broad-spectrum sunscreen is the most effective way to prevent photoaging and maintain skin elasticity [5]. Wear hats and seek shade during peak sun hours.
  3. Adopt a Nutrient-Rich Diet: Ensure adequate intake of vitamins, minerals, and protein to support bone health and skin vitality [8]. Stay hydrated by drinking plenty of water.
  4. Avoid Smoking: Quitting smoking or never starting is one of the most impactful steps you can take for your skin and overall health [5].
  5. Manage Stress and Get Sufficient Sleep: Chronic stress and lack of sleep can negatively impact skin health and accelerate visible signs of aging.
  6. Maintain a Healthy Weight: Significant fluctuations in weight can affect facial fat volume and skin elasticity.
  7. Consider Professional Skincare: Consult with dermatologists or skincare professionals for personalized advice and treatments to address specific aging concerns.
